Congratulations to Sandrine Gourlet: a new era for the Union des ports de France

At the Assises de l'économie de la mer, held in La Rochelle on November 4 and 5, Sandrine Gourlet was unanimously elected president of the Union des ports de France (UPF).Sandrine Gourlet was unanimously elected president of the Union des ports de France (UPF), marking a turning point for the trade association, the voice of French port operators.

Sandrine Gourlet succeeds Jean-Pierre Chalus, taking over the reins of a key institution for the development of port infrastructures in France. A qualified engineer with 25 years' experience in transport and development for the French government and local authorities, she embodies recognized expertise and a strategic vision for the sector.


Since May 2024, she has headed the Grand Port Maritime de La Rochelle, a major asset in her new role. Her election as head of the UPF confirms the confidence placed in her ability to federate the sector's players and take up the challenges of the ecological and economic transition of French ports.

Sandrine Gourlet will not be alone at the helm. She can count on the support of two vice-presidents: Benoît Rochet, Chairman of Haropa Port, and Christine Rosso, Director of Toulon Ports and Concessions. Together, they will form a complementary trio, combining experience, innovation and territorial roots.

This appointment comes at a particularly dynamic time for the maritime sector. The Assises de l'économie de la mer, organized in La Rochelle, are an opportunity to reflect on future challenges: decarbonization of transport, modernization of infrastructures, attractiveness of French ports internationally. Sandrine Gourlet and her team will have a central role to play in all these areas.
